Alto’s Adventure

Alto’s Adventure is a visually stunning game that is perfect for a quick gaming session on a commute. The game involves guiding Alto, a snowboarder, down a mountain while avoiding obstacles and collecting coins. The game’s calming music and beautiful graphics make for a relaxing and enjoyable experience that is perfect for a short commute.

Threes!

A simple but addictive puzzle game, Threes! involves combining tiles of matching numbers to create higher numbers. It’s very minimalist in what it is, but that’s the beauty of it, allowing you to pick it up and put it down with ease. Which is what you want with a commute game. After all, you don’t want to miss your stop!

Mini Metro

Ideal for travelling into London, Mini Metro is a strategy game that involves building and managing a subway system in a growing city. Players must plan routes and manage resources to keep their subway system running smoothly, and the game’s minimalist design and calming music make it a great option for a quick gaming session on a commute.

Monument Valley

It’s likely you’ll have heard of Monument Valley, a puzzle game that involves navigating a character through a series of mind-bending architectural landscapes. The game’s stunning visuals and creative level design make it a great option for a short commute, as it can provide a brief escape into a visually captivating world.
